# 9. Mac OS Permissions to send keyboard keys via the MP MIDI app

<span dir="ltr">With the September 2024 of the MP MIDI App update and the feature to send keyboard keys, Mac OS needs the following permissions on the small utility app we have created for sending keyboard keys.</span>

<span dir="ltr">The SendKeysMP app needs to run along with the MP MIDI app. It does not matter which you run first, the MP MIDI app or SendKeysMP. You can set SendKeysMP to run automatically when you start your Mac (see the last section for instructions).</span>

<span dir="ltr">Run the SendKeysMP installer follow the steps below to provide the necessary permissions. </span>

<p class="callout info"><span dir="ltr">Please note that you need to follow the steps exactly as they are described below.   
The MacOS asks for permissions twice, so we need to start and stop the app twice to complete the permission's process. Adding the SendKeys app to the System Settings manually will not work.</span></p>

1\. Navigate to the Applications &gt; SendKeysMP folder and double click on SendKeysMP.app. This application does not have a window.

Click Allow

<span dir="ltr">2. Double click on the stop the app run the **StopSendKeysMP.app** from the Applications &gt; SendKeysMP folder. This application does not have a window. </span>

<span dir="ltr">3. Run the SendKeysMP.app again. You will be prompted with this message.</span>

<span dir="ltr">Choose to Open System Settings.</span>

4\. Select Privacy &amp; Security

<span dir="ltr">Then from within Privacy and Security, choose Accessibility</span>

<span dir="ltr">Enable the SendKeysMP.app switching it to enabled from the right slide button.</span>

<span dir="ltr">5. Double click on the stop the app run the **StopSendKeysMP.app** from the Applications &gt; SendKeysMP folder. This application does not have a window. </span>

<span dir="ltr">Run the SendKeys.app again. Now it has access to send keys to your apps.</span>

<p class="callout info"><span dir="ltr">Optionally, after the prior steps, you can add the SendKeysMP.app to Login items in System Settings to start automatically when you start your Mac computer. This will way you don't have to run SendKeysMP every time you want to send keyboard keys from the MP MIDI app.</span></p>
